Project tutorial
Stop Smoking Device

Stop Smoking Device © LGPL

The FIRST stop smoking device! !

  • 5,844 views
  • 0 comments
  • 14 respects

Components and supplies

Necessary tools and machines

3drag
3D Printer (generic)

Apps and online services

About this project

The first of its kind. It's a self-locking, timer-based, Arduino-controlled Stop Smoking Device. Simple and easy to create at home!

This project was done just for fun. It wasn't my intention to actually complete a fun silly project like this, but oh well... I like doing random weird things! :-)

How to Create and Assemble

Software

Model Design: Autodesk Fusion 360

https://www.autodesk.com/products/fusion-360/overview

3D Print Slicer Software: Simplify3D

https://www.simplify3d.com

Coding Software: Arduino IDE

https://www.arduino.cc/en/Main/Software

3D Printer Used

Creality CR-10

Downloads

* Simplify3D FFF Profile :

https://drive.google.com/file/d/1-TfH9DUCZc4nzN2ZJMSy9FnOEDAzsuz6/view?usp=sharing

* 3D Model Parts :

https://www.thingiverse.com/thing:3029694

* Arduino Code and Libraries :

https://drive.google.com/file/d/1R64IdvDMJaonX0QHGQ3Nn3jmhyMWZa7Q/view?usp=sharing

Components Used

  • 1 x Arduino Uno
  • 1 x OLED display module white 0.96-inch 128x64 6-pin SPI for Arduino
  • 1 x TOWERPRO Mini 9g hobby servo SG90
  • 1 x tactile 4.3mm horizontal button
  • 2 x Samsung 18650-30Q 3000mAh battery
  • 1 x 18650 battery holder

Code

StopSmoking-Arduino.zipArduino
No preview (download only).

Custom parts and enclosures

Get parts from Thingiverse

Schematics

Basics
Please refer to code for exact pin usage
20180728 130049 39rol4mflj

Comments

Similar projects you might like

Carfox: A Device to Find Them All

Project tutorial by Luis Roda Sánchez

  • 7,955 views
  • 2 comments
  • 29 respects

Arduino Bluetooth Robot for Android Device

Project showcase by aip06

  • 4,378 views
  • 2 comments
  • 19 respects

Arduino Uno + Electrical Device (Bulb) + Android Phone

Project tutorial by Stephen Simon

  • 10,216 views
  • 9 comments
  • 40 respects

Safe City: A Device to Keep You Safe

Project tutorial by Patel Darshil

  • 9,451 views
  • 1 comment
  • 26 respects

Arduino Powered CPR Feedback Device

Project showcase by David Escobar

  • 6,370 views
  • 9 comments
  • 30 respects

LoRa E32 Device for Arduino, ESP32 or ESP8266: Library

Project tutorial by Renzo Mischianti

  • 3,677 views
  • 2 comments
  • 20 respects
Add projectSign up / Login